An automotive position sensor serves to detect and transmit the location of critical vehicle components such as the throttle, camshaft, or crankshaft to the electronic control unit (ECU). This data is essential for optimizing performance, improving fuel efficiency, and controlling emissions in modern automotive systems.
There are several types of automotive position sensors, including multi-axis, angular, linear, and others. Multi-axis sensors can detect movement along multiple axes, providing detailed spatial and orientational information about vehicle components. These sensors find widespread use across passenger cars, light commercial vehicles, and heavy commercial vehicles, and are available through various sales channels such as original equipment manufacturers (OEMs) and the aftermarket. They are utilized in a range of applications including clutch, brake, and accelerator pedals, engine transmission and suspension, gear shifters, chassis components, and more.

Tariffs are affecting the automotive position sensor market by increasing the cost of imported semiconductors, magnetic materials, sensor housings, precision connectors, and microcontrollers. Automotive OEMs in North America and Europe are particularly impacted due to dependence on imported sensor components, while Asia-Pacific suppliers face export pricing challenges. These tariffs are increasing sensor costs and slowing system upgrades. However, they are also encouraging regional semiconductor sourcing, localized sensor assembly, and innovation in cost-efficient and integrated position sensing solutions.

The automotive position sensor market size has grown strongly in recent years. It will grow from $6.01 billion in 2025 to $6.38 billion in 2026 at a compound annual growth rate (CAGR) of 6.2%. The growth in the historic period can be attributed to electronic control unit proliferation, demand for engine control accuracy, safety system adoption, sensor miniaturization, vehicle electrification.
The automotive position sensor market size is expected to see strong growth in the next few years. It will grow to $7.98 billion in 2030 at a compound annual growth rate (CAGR) of 5.7%. The growth in the forecast period can be attributed to autonomous driving growth, ev sensor demand, smart chassis systems, sensor fusion adoption, advanced driver assistance expansion. Major trends in the forecast period include increasing use of multi-axis sensors, growth of contactless sensing technologies, integration with adas systems, demand for high-precision position detection, expansion of electronic control systems.
The increasing demand for electric vehicles is set to drive growth in the automotive position sensor market. Electric vehicles (EVs) are powered by electric motors utilizing energy stored in rechargeable batteries or other storage devices. This demand surge is driven by environmental concerns, technological advancements, government incentives, and expanding charging infrastructure. Automotive position sensors play a crucial role in EVs by accurately monitoring and controlling component positions, thereby enhancing performance, safety, and efficiency. For example, in July 2023, the International Energy Agency reported a 25% year-on-year increase in electric car sales, reaching over 2.3 million units in the first quarter alone. Sales are projected to grow further, reaching 14 million units by the end of 2023, reflecting a 35% annual increase and accelerated growth in the latter half of the year. Thus, the rising demand for electric vehicles is propelling the automotive position sensor market forward.
Leading companies in the automotive position sensor market are innovating with products such as hall technology sensors to meet the demand for precise and reliable position sensing in vehicles, enhancing overall performance, safety, and efficiency. Hall technology sensors detect and measure magnetic fields, providing essential data for various automotive and industrial applications. For instance, TDK Corporation introduced the HAL 3927 in October 2023, a 3D HAL technology-based position sensor featuring ratiometric analog output and digital SENT interface based on SAE J2716 rev. 4 standards. This sensor enables high-resolution position measurements with linear, ratiometric analog output and integrated wire-break detection. The HAL 3927 sensor is capable of measuring horizontal and vertical magnetic-field components, facilitating linear and rotary position measurements up to 360°. Its programmable output characteristic supports linearization of the output signal through up to 33 setpoints.
In February 2023, CTS Corporation bolstered its position in the electric motor sensing and control markets by acquiring maglab AG, although the financial terms were undisclosed. This acquisition enriches CTS' technology portfolio, reinforcing its market position and capabilities. maglab AG is a Switzerland-based company that provides automotive position sensors.
